What roof dust simply is

Black streaks seem like dust, yet on such a lot asphalt roofs they’re cyanobacteria, in many instances Gloeocapsa magma. The streaks unfold from the ridge downward since rain includes the colonies alongside the granule surface. Lichens and moss from time to time comply with, fantastically on shaded slopes under reside o.k. or tall pines. In coastal parts like Horry and Georgetown counties, salt crystals and wind-blown sand upload abrasion, and pine pollen sticks to the whole lot. Tile and steel roofs have unique textures, yet they accumulate the related algae and may corrode in which particles remains damp.

Algae isn’t simply cosmetic. On shingles, it holds moisture and raises roof temperature by cutting back reflectivity, which may speed up aging. Moss is worse. Its rhizoids dig into granules and continue water in opposition t the shingle mat, a recipe for shortened lifestyles and winter hurt in colder climates. On clay or concrete tile, moss creeps into joints and can loosen the bedding through the years. Cleaning helps, however the way concerns.

Pressure washers and roofs: buddy or foe?

The term “force washing” indicates blasting dust away, that's precisely what you ought to no longer do on so much roofs. High tension removes shingle granules and drives water up less than laps and flashing. I have obvious owners peel a decade of lifestyles off a roof in an hour with a 3,000 PSI computing device. On cement tile, too much pressure etches the surface and opens the door to rapid re-progress. Even on metallic roofs, the wrong tip perspective can push water beyond seams and into insulation.

The nontoxic play makes use of both very low power, usually referred to as cushy washing, or careful rinsing mixed with chemicals that kill healthy improvement. Think of it like washing a wool sweater: you dissolve the grime, then rinse gently.

Soft washing explained

Soft washing skill using a cleaning resolution at backyard-hose stress, letting it live, then rinsing with low drive, most often lower than three hundred PSI. Most pros use a committed pump to apply a diluted sodium hypochlorite mix, oftentimes with additives that thicken the answer and help it cling to the roof, and a surfactant to reduce floor rigidity. The resolution kills algae, moss, and lichen with no mechanical abrasion. Rinsing is elective for asphalt shingles depending on climate and aesthetic alternative. Rains will almost always elevate away the dead boom over days to weeks.

The chemistry sounds intimidating, however it’s honest should you appreciate it. The blend ratio relies upon on roof subject matter and severity of growth. Asphalt shingles with heavy streaking frequently reply to a three to four percentage sodium hypochlorite answer on the roof surface. Lighter expansion can smooth up with 1 to two p.c.. Clay and urban tile, which might be more difficult to penetrate but additionally extra porous, may additionally want three to five percent utilized and stored moist lengthy sufficient to work. Metal roofs by and large clean nicely on the scale down end given that the slick floor releases improvement effortlessly. Always test a small section, and modify rather than guessing high. More chemical than necessary doesn’t help the roof and increases the menace to landscaping.

Safety first on any roof

Before conversing methodology, recall the possibility. Working on a roof with hoses and wet surfaces calls for sober making plans. A harness and a genuine anchor level sound like overkill until you slip on a rainy lichen patch. I discovered that lesson at eight a.m. on a shaded north slope, in which dew grew to become the floor into ice. The roof pitch, access points, and the condition of the shingles or tiles all form the plan. If you really feel uneasy jogging the floor, you commonly shouldn’t be up there.

Footwear with smooth rubber soles, not tired footwear, makes a big difference. On brittle shingles older than 15 years or on warm days when asphalt softens, remain off the roof if you possibly can. Work from a ladder with standoffs, or use a telescoping wand for application and rinse.

Protecting the belongings subjects as tons as non-public safeguard. Soft wash mixes can brown shrubs and lawn rapid than a warmth wave. Pre-soak crops and soil round the house, divert downspouts clear of planting beds, and preserve a hoseman committed to rinsing flora at the same time chemical compounds are at paintings. Cover comfortable crops with breathable material how to power wash driveways rather than plastic, which traps warm and might do greater hurt than the cleansing answer.

The good apparatus and setup

Think of the manner in three parts: program, stay management, and rinse.

Application: A dedicated delicate wash pump with chemical-resistant seals improves handle. Many professionals use 12-volt diaphragm pumps or air diaphragm pumps that give 1 to 6 gallons according to minute at forty to one hundred PSI. A downstream injector on a stress washing machine can work for easy algae, but it on the whole limits the highest chemical energy at the nozzle. For roofs with obdurate increase, a committed pump allows you to acquire aim percentages reliably.

Dwell handle: A clingy surfactant helps to keep the answer in position on pitched surfaces. The aim is to rainy the growth safely, no longer flood it. Reapply lightly to maintain the floor rainy for 10 to fifteen mins with no runoff. Avoid running in direct, severe solar in which evaporation quickens. Asphalt shingles call for additonal restraint

Asphalt shingles depend upon ceramic granules to preserve the asphalt mat from UV destroy. High power turns the ones granules into glitter within the gutter. Aim to evade mechanical abrasion altogether. The comfortable wash procedure kills algae and lichen so they liberate with no scrubbing. If some obdurate lichen islands hang on, deal with those spots once more and provide them per week. Picking or scraping basically leaves a obvious scar within the granules.

If the roof has algae-resistant shingles, you’ll still see streaking once the factory copper or zinc granules lose effectiveness, commonly after 7 to 10 years. It cleans like every other shingle roof, however that you can ceaselessly step down the chemical energy a little bit, relatively if you re-treat most likely.

Tile and metallic: different surfaces, equal principles

Clay and urban tile can cope with more rinse go with the flow, however use warning with power. The floor will be porous, and repeated aggressive washing opens greater pores. That roughness invites sooner re-expansion, which becomes a cycle. Keep the psi low and let chemistry do the heavy lifting. Take care around ridge caps and mortar beds, which every so often mask small leaks. A mushy rinse displays them with no forcing water within.

Metal roofs receive advantages from short, helpful cleansing. Algae doesn’t root into steel, so it releases shortly once treated. Avoid angling water uphill at status-seam joints or fastener lines. If there’s a manufacturing facility-applied coating, study the organization’s guidance. Harsh chemical substances can boring finishes over time. A mid-force tender wash mix with thorough rinse and brand new water flush of gutters balances outcomes and toughness.

How lengthy consequences last, and learn how to stretch them

On a normal Myrtle Beach asphalt roof, a thorough comfortable wash continues streaks away for 18 to 36 months, relying on colour and within reach bushes. Tile and metallic more often than not continue to be clear on the longer give up, incredibly with better airflow and less overhanging limbs. You can lengthen that by way of trimming branches to open the roof to faded and breeze, cleaning gutters so water doesn’t overflow and feed moss, and setting up zinc or copper strips alongside the ridge. Rain consists of ions from the metal throughout the roof surface, which slows algae progress. It’s now not a silver bullet, however it buys time.

Homeowners on occasion ask for the strongest achieveable mixture to refreshing “once and for all.” That’s now not how biology works. Preventive maintenance wins. A pale repairs treatment at the first signal of streaks uses much less chemical, much less time, and stresses the roof less than waiting until eventually the floor is black.

The chemistry, without the jargon

Sodium hypochlorite customer experiences with Power Washing Advanced Power Wash is the lively ingredient in such a lot roof wash options. It breaks down organic and natural expansion simply and, when diluted and rinsed appropriately, leaves minimum residue. Surfactants help the answer unfold and adhere, decreasing runoff and making improvements to touch time. Some techs add sodium percarbonate for moss in cooler climates, which releases oxygen, but it works slower and most commonly necessities agitation that roofs can’t have enough money. Acidic neutralizers are generally used after cleansing to slash slip and balance residues on home windows or metals, however generous clean water always does the task.

Avoid cocktail mixes that promise miracles. More components complicate rinsing and may react with metals or coatings. Keep it elementary: the excellent percentage, perfect dwell, and managed rinse.

Aftercare: what you’ll see in the days ahead

Right after a cushy wash, black streaks fade dramatically. Lichen and moss discolor and begin to release, but some stay seen like white or tan ghosts. Over one to a few weeks, rainfall loosens and gets rid of the remnants. On tile roofs, lifeless growth can also manifest as gentle flakes that shed with the subsequent hurricane. If you’re worried about specks last after per week of dry weather, a gentle rinse facilitates, yet keep away from scrubbing.

Windows normally demonstrate faint recognizing from surfactant mist. A swift wash with plain water or a easy glass cleanser clears it. Patio furniture and decks within reach may also suppose barely slick; a hose rinse returns the commonly used sense.
